The Bait (pledge) and Velayat (saintliness)
When he was began growing up, his fondness was beginning and also increasing. In his younger age, there were absorption and intoxication were also available to him. At that time there was one pious personality was living and his name is Khaja Shamsuddin Mohammed Chisti. His father presented him in the presence of Khaja Shamsuddin Mohammed Chisti and who was accepted him and included him in his lineage and he told “ He is our face”. After the completion of his pledge the saying of his spiritual master about him that he is our face is not a general matter, but it was an argument in this matter and it shows that he was a true disciple.

The pledge (Bait) is mentioned in Quran
Allah says in Quran “ Ya ahayul lazina amanu attaqu llah wab taqu alye al wasilata.” Its meaning is “ Oh: people of Iman (faith) fear of Allah and search and find the source to reach Him.”
Hadrat Pir Mohammed Karam Shah Alazhari was mentioned in the exegesis Zia UL Quran that the thing with its help to reach somebody and to get his nearness is termed as source. Iman (faith), good deeds, the worship, and the following of the Sunnah (practice) of the prophet and it will keep us away from sins and all these things are sources and means to reach the nearest of Allah. The signs of a perfect spiritual master are as follows.
1. To remove the bandage of carelessness from the eyes of the disciple with the spiritual attention.
2. To create the eagerness of the love of Allah.
If the spiritual master will possesses the above qualities then there will be no doubt about the source of the spiritual master.
As per reference from the book ‘Qaul Jamil’ Hazrat Shah Wali al- Allah Muhadith Dehalavi says in the above verse wasila refers to the pledge of the spiritual master.
Hadrat Shah Ismail Dehlavi says the mystic and the people on the path of Haqiqat (truth) have taken the meaning of wasila as the spiritual master.
So for getting the real success and triumph before endeavours and Riyazat (mystic exercise) then it is most necessary thing to search a spiritual master in this matter. Allah made these rules for the path of mystic persons. So without the guidance of the spiritual master it is rare to get the right path.
